You are to demonstrate that you understand slope. You are to draw two graphs of lines. One line needs to have a slope of 2/3 and

the second line needs to have a slope of -4.
Mathematics
1 answer:
Semmy [17]3 years ago
6 0

In mathematics, the slope is used to describe the steepness and direction of straight lines.

Then knowing the slope and one point in the line , you can write the equation of this line.

If m is the slope of the line

The equation of this line is Y = mX + d  

d indicates the intersection point of the line with the y-axis, where X=0 (0,d)

To draw a line in the coordinate system (x,y), we have to calculate two points and then draw a line that passes through those two points. The first point is the intersection of the line with the vertical y-axis. We already know that it is (0,d) and another point can be the intersection of the line with the horizontal x-axis. To find it we have to substitute in the equation making Y = 0.

First equation : Y = 2/3X + b  where b is any value where the line will cut to the y-axis

intersection point of this line with the vertical y-axis => (0,b)

intersection point of this line with the horizontal x-axis, making Y=0

2X/3 + b = 0

X = -3b/2

intersection point of the line with the horizontal x-axis => (-3b/2,0)

Second equation : Y = -4X + c where c is any value where this line will cut to the y-axis

intersection point of the line with the vertical y-axis => (0,c)

intersection point of this line with the horizontal x-axis, making Y=0  

-4X + c = 0

X = -c/-4 = c/4

intersection point of the line with the horizontal x-axis => (c/4,0)

Determine the equation of the inverse of y=1/4x^3-2
dedylja [7]

<u>Answer</u>


y⁻¹ = ∛(4x+8)



<u>Explanation</u>

y=(1/4)x³ - 2.

To find the inverse of this equation, you first make x the subject of the formular.

y=(1/4)x³ - 2

Multiply both sides by 4;

4y = x³ - 8

Add 8 on both sides of the equation;

4y + 8 = x³

x³ = 4y + 8

Apply the cube root on both sides to get the value of x;

x = ∛(4y+8)


The inverse of y=(1/4)x³ - 2 is;

y⁻¹ = ∛(4x+8)

Anyone know 14!!!!! Please help me!!!!!:(
asambeis [7]

-- They're losing employees . . . so you know that the line will slope down, and
its slope is negative;

-- They're losing employees at a steady rate . . . so you know that the slope is
the same everywhere on the line; this tells you that the graph is a straight line.

I can see the function right now, but I'll show you how to go through the steps to
find the function.  I need to point out that these are steps that you've gone through
many times, but now that the subject pops up in a real-world situation, suddenly
you're running around in circles with your hair on fire screaming "What do I do ? 
Somebody give me the answer !".

Just take a look at what has already been handed to you:

0 months . . . 65 employees
1 month . . . . 62 employees
2 months . . . 59 employees

You know three points on the line !

(0, 65) ,  (1, 62) ,  and  (2, 59) .

For the first point, 'x' happens to be zero, so immediately
you have your y-intercept !    ' b ' = 65 .

You can use any two of the points to find the slope of the line.
You will calculate that the slope is negative-3 . . . which you
might have realized as you read the story, looked at the numbers,
and saw that they are <u>firing 3 employees per month</u>.
("Losing" them doesn't quite capture the true spirit of what is happening.)

So your function ... call it ' W(n) ' . . . Workforce after 'n' months . . .

is           <em>W(n) = 65 - 3n</em> .
